Currently the Sorcerer skill "Bound Armor" and its morphs casts an entire suit of heavy Daedric (or Xivkyn, for the Stamina morph) armor over the user. In a game which seems to value character individualism, this one skill makes all sorcerers who use it look like the exact same vanilla character. I think @Gyudan said it best, "I hate that the most effective way to play a sorcerer is to hide the armor selection I spent a long time designing and to put on this monstrosity instead." Frankly, it's stupid.

For reference, regardless of what your character looks like or is wearing, when you use the skill, you look like this:
2nasgi0.jpg
*The body gender and shape, is dependent upon your character. Props to @Ladiev for the image.

I'd like to see the armor removed entirely, and instead see something akin to every other skill ever. Even if you had the glowing Daedric face on your chest, or a bubble, or your outfit had sheen, or whatever else that isn't replacing your entire outfit, it would be better.
